SpletThere are four major risks associated with fixed income: Interest rate risk When interest rates rise, bond prices fall, meaning the bonds you hold lose value. Interest rate movements are the major cause of price volatility in bond markets. Inflation risk Inflation is another source of risk for bond investors.
